Moreover, China reports only one death from swine flu for its nearly 16,000 cases, which would give it a success rate in treatment better than all other countries in the world save for Germany. China's one reported death is equivalent to the number of reported deaths in the Solomon Islands, St. Kitts and the Cook Islands, among other tiny countries with few cases (Flucount.org, 2009). It is difficult for citizens and authorities to truly understand the nature of the swine flu epidemic, due to the fact that each different jurisdiction reports its own numbers.
